I am well aware now that eating Paleo takes work, and preparation. Every kind of food that you could easily grab before heading out the door is pretty much off limits. A yogurt, a granola bar... the usual culprits are non-paleo. We're limited to meats and veggies and those aren't exactly super accessible. And most things placed in front of you don't fall into this category either.
